Excel如何准确计算日期?日期计算公式怎么用?
作者:佚名|分类:EXCEL|浏览:93|发布时间:2025-04-02 18:32:08
Excel如何准确计算日期?日期计算公式怎么用?
在Excel中,日期是一个非常重要的数据类型,它可以帮助我们进行时间序列分析、计算时间差等操作。准确计算日期不仅能够提高工作效率,还能确保数据分析的准确性。本文将详细介绍如何在Excel中准确计算日期,以及如何使用日期计算公式。
一、Excel日期的基本概念
在Excel中,日期是以1900年1月1日为基准的序列号来表示的。例如,1900年1月1日是序列号1,1900年1月2日是序列号2,以此类推。这种表示方法使得Excel中的日期计算变得非常方便。
二、如何输入日期
在Excel中,输入日期有几种常见的方法:
1. 直接输入日期:例如,输入“2023/1/1”或“2023-1-1”。
2. 使用单元格格式:选中单元格,右键点击,选择“设置单元格格式”,在“数字”选项卡中选择“日期”格式,然后选择合适的日期格式。
三、日期计算公式
Excel提供了多种日期计算公式,以下是一些常用的公式:
1. NOW()函数:返回当前日期和时间。
语法:=NOW()
例如:=NOW() A1(计算当前日期与单元格A1之间的天数)
2. TODAY()函数:返回当前日期。
语法:=TODAY()
例如:=TODAY() A1(计算当前日期与单元格A1之间的天数)
3. DATE()函数:返回指定年月日的日期。
语法:=DATE(年, 月, 日)
例如:=DATE(2023, 1, 1)(返回2023年1月1日的日期)
4. DATEDIF()函数:计算两个日期之间的差异。
语法:=DATEDIF(开始日期, 结束日期, 单位)
例如:=DATEDIF(A1, A2, "Y")(计算单元格A1和A2之间的年份差异)
5. EOMONTH()函数:返回指定日期所在月份的最后一天。
语法:=EOMONTH(开始日期, 月份)
例如:=EOMONTH(A1, 0)(返回单元格A1所在月份的最后一天)
6. YEAR()、MONTH()、DAY()函数:分别返回日期的年、月、日部分。
语法:=YEAR(日期)、=MONTH(日期)、=DAY(日期)
例如:=YEAR(A1)、=MONTH(A1)、=DAY(A1)
四、日期计算公式应用实例
1. 计算两个日期之间的天数:
假设A1单元格为“2023/1/1”,A2单元格为“2023/1/10”,则计算两个日期之间天数的公式为:=A2 A1。
2. 计算当前日期与指定日期之间的天数:
假设A1单元格为“2023/1/1”,则计算当前日期与A1单元格之间天数的公式为:=TODAY() A1。
3. 计算指定日期所在月份的最后一天:
假设A1单元格为“2023/1/15”,则计算A1单元格所在月份最后一天的公式为:=EOMONTH(A1, 0)。
五、相关问答
1. 问题:如何将日期转换为序列号?
回答:在Excel中,日期本身就是以序列号的形式存储的。例如,2023年1月1日的序列号为43889。你可以直接将日期单元格的值转换为数字,或者在公式中使用DATE函数来获取序列号。
2. 问题:如何计算两个日期之间的月份差异?
回答:可以使用DATEDIF函数来计算两个日期之间的月份差异。例如,=DATEDIF(A1, A2, "M")将计算单元格A1和A2之间的月份差异。
3. 问题:如何将日期转换为文本格式?
回答:选中需要转换的日期单元格,右键点击,选择“设置单元格格式”,在“数字”选项卡中选择“文本”格式即可。
4. 问题:如何计算两个日期之间的工作日?
回答:可以使用WORKDAY函数来计算两个日期之间的工作日。例如,=WORKDAY(A1, 1)将计算从A1单元格日期开始的第一个工作日。
通过以上内容,相信你已经掌握了在Excel中准确计算日期的方法。在实际应用中,灵活运用这些公式,能够帮助你更高效地处理日期相关的数据。